“Gabby” Gabreski, son of Polish immigrants, became the top USAAF fighter ace in Europe during World War II, achieving a rare feat by also becoming an ace in the Korean War. He served for 26 years, reaching the rank of Colonel.

Though his initial training was unremarkable, Gabreski’s passion for flying led him to volunteer for RAF duty with Polish pilots. This experience taught him the vital skill of maintaining composure in combat.

Assigned to the 56th Fighter Group in Europe, flying the P-47 Thunderbolt, Gabreski quickly rose to command, despite some initial skepticism from his peers. In the European theater, he achieved an unprecedented 28 aerial victories against the Luftwaffe.

Even after reaching the required flight hours for a return home, Gabreski opted for one more mission. His Thunderbolt was damaged during a strafing run, forcing him to crash land. He evaded capture for five days before being taken prisoner, ultimately ending up in a German POW camp.
